you can do it with a formula. With both workbooks open, in the
destination cell type "=" and then change workbook and point to the
cell, which you want copied. When you have pointed to the correct cell
press Enter to commit the formula and return to the cell.

If both workbooks are open changes in the source will be automatically
updated in the destination.
If destination only opens it will display the last saved value and ask
you if you want the link updated.
